Princess Kate’s Remembrance Sunday appearance
Tobias Kormind, Managing Director of Europe’s largest online diamond jeweller 77 Diamonds has shared an insight into what sparkling jewels the Princess of Wales may boast on Sunday during her expected attendance.
Kormind explained: “For this year’s Remembrance Service at the Cenotaph, the Princess of Wales’ jewellery will undoubtedly be chosen with care and purpose. We can expect her to complement her dark, often military-inspired attire with a pair of elegant pearl earrings, a traditional choice among royal women for solemn occasions.
“In past years, Catherine has worn both the Collingwood and the Bahrain Pearl Earrings, pieces that honoured her late mother-in-law, Diana, Princess of Wales, and the late Queen Elizabeth II, who served in the Auxiliary Territorial Service during World War Two, becoming the first female member of the British Royal family to join the armed forces. Alongside minimal accessories, she is likely to wear her customary trio of poppies and the brooch of the 1st The Queen’s Dragoon Guards, originally crafted for Queen Elizabeth, the Queen Mother, symbolising the royal family’s enduring link to the Armed Forces.“
Princess Kate has paid tribute to members of the royal family who are no longer with us by choosing special jewellery that evokes a memory of them.

Princess Kate’s tribute to Queen Elizabeth
In September, Princess Kate paid tribute to Queen Elizabeth with an aspect of her clothing.
The royals gathered at Westminster Cathedral on September 16 where a catholic funeral service took place to lay the late Duchess of Kent to rest after she passed away on September 4.
Princess Kate pulled pieces from her wardrobe that she had already worn, to say goodbye to the Duchess of Kent.
Kate sported a chic, black Catherine Walker coat dress, the same dress that she wore at Prince Philip’s funeral.
She made the outfit look especially chic by wearing sheer black tights and Gianvito Rossi heels.
The focal point of the outfit, however, was her distinctive pillbox hat from Jane Taylor.
The hat in question features a satin bow and a birdcage veil.
Princess Kate previously worn the unique accessory at Queen Elizabeth’s state funeral, where she followed Her Majesty’s coffin on September 19, 2022.
Kate Middleton’s engagement ring
Princess Kate has also worn a number of pieces of jewellery that once belonged to Princess Diana.
Most notably, her engagement ring.
Back in 2010, Prince William proposed to Kate with his late mother Princess Diana’s engagement ring.
It features a 12-carat, oval-cut Ceylon blue sapphire from Sri Lanka.
